I did just stay in a Brussels 4* hotel a few weeks ago. My winning bid was $57, but the dollar was stronger against the euro then, and rates might be higher in the summer. For rooms starting June 28, you only have three days in which to bid - 25, 26, and 27 (I just tried, and couldn't do a "same day" bid for Brussels, so am assuming you can't bid on the 28th although the time zone difference might be causing that).There are various ways you can play this, but I think with the short amount of time left it might be wise to just jump in at the $60 level for the 4*. You could maybe try the $55 first, and then raise your bid when the 24 hours is up if you are willing to get that close to when you need the rooms. And if you still aren't successful, you could then lower the star level to 3.5* and then 3*.Hope it works for you.Romelle
